Know Your Financing Options
It is likely that once a property comes on the market you may not be the only person interested in purchasing it. That is why it is so important for you to know how you are going to purchase the house. Once you know you will also need to secure documentation showing proof of funds or an approval for the amount that you are offering on the property. This is a requirement for the offer to be submitted and presented to the seller.

Know the Neighborhood
When you are ready to submit an offer you should have some familiarity with the area. Knowing what the selling points are of the area and what attracts buyers. What are the schools like? Are there neighborhood parks? Running trails or lakes? Is the neighborhood walkable, meaning close proximity to dining and entertainment. These elements will all be an important part of the marketing once the renovation is complete. As the seller you can include all these details on an overview sheet in the home for prospective buyers to view.

Know How to Determine Your Offer
Preparing ahead of time will allow you to have a general idea of pricing when it comes time to write an offer. You will need a general idea of renovation costs based upon your walk through. If you haven’t renovated a home yet make sure to prepare before your first project by attending real estate investment meetings and reaching out to contractors to get general pricing.
If you have planned ahead you will also have an idea of the resale values of homes in the area. This may be research you gathered before or with the help of a knowledgeable real estate professional. Not only will this guide you in your offer price but it will direct you as to what level of renovations will be required to achieve that sale price.
